1.安装pyredis(1)使用 #easy_install redis(2)直接编译安装#wget https://pypi.python.org/packages/source/r/redis/redis-2.9.1.tar.gz #tar xvzf redis-2.9.1.tar.gz #cdredis-2.9.1 #python setup.pyinstall2.简单的redis操作red
1、redis类型介绍:redis有五种基本类型:字符串类型、散列类型、列表类型、集合类型、有序集合类型。每种不同的类型,reids客户端提供了很多不同的操作方法,下面即将演示最常用的一些基于python的操作2、python使用pip安装redis:pip install redis3、源码分享:# coding:utf-8 import redis r = redis.Redis(host='
# 实现"python redis 存储json"的教程 ## 1. 流程概述 首先,我们需要明确整个实现过程的流程,可以通过表格展示步骤: | 步骤 | 描述 | | ---- | -------------------- | | 1 | 连接 Redis 数据库 | | 2 | 将 JSON 数据序列化 | | 3 | 存储序列
原创 2024-03-25 07:28:25
109阅读
# Python RedisJSON 在 Web 开发中,我们经常会用到 Redis 这个高性能 key-value 存储数据库,而 JSON 这个数据格式也是非常常用的数据交换格式。将 JSON 数据存储到 Redis 中,可以方便地进行数据的读取和存储。本篇文章将介绍如何使用 PythonJSON 数据存储到 Redis 中,并通过代码示例进行演示。 ## Redis 简介
原创 2024-03-02 04:05:49
99阅读
# 用Python操作Redis存储字典数据的方法 Redis是一个开源的内存数据库,常用于缓存和消息传递。在Python中,我们可以使用redis-py库来连接和操作Redis数据库。在本文中,我们将探讨如何使用Redis存储字典数据,并将其转换为JSON格式。 ## 安装redis-py库 首先,我们需要安装redis-py库。可以通过以下命令来安装: ```bash pip inst
原创 2024-06-16 05:25:21
40阅读
# 如何实现Python Redis存储JSON数据 ## 一、整体流程 我们首先来看一下整个过程的步骤: ```mermaid gantt title Python Redis存储JSON数据流程图 section 完成步骤 学习Redis基础知识 :done, 2022-01-01, 1d 安装Redis
原创 2024-03-08 07:17:23
22阅读
源码版本:redis-4.0.1 源码位置: dict.h:dictEntry、dictht、dict等数据结构定义。 dict.c:创建、插入、查找等功能实现。一、dict 简介dict (dictionary 字典),通常的存储结构是Key-Value形式的,通过Hash函数对key求Hash值来确定Value的位置,因此也叫Hash表,是一种用来解决算法中查找问题的数据结构,默认的算法复杂
转载 2024-09-05 21:10:48
36阅读
redis连接1,安装redis pip install redis 实例: import redis from datetime import datetime r = redis.Redis(host='localhost', port=6379, db=15,decode_responses=True) r.set('name', 'lvye') print(r['name']
转载 2023-09-23 17:33:35
132阅读
Python json 模块简介JSON(JavaScript Object Notation, JS 对象标记) 是一种轻量级的数据交换格式。JSON的数据格式其实就是python里面的字典格式,里面可以包含方括号括起来的数组,也就是python里面的列表。在python中,有专门处理json格式的模块—— json 和 picle模块  Json &nb
转载 2023-08-09 21:03:50
94阅读
如何使用PythonRedis保存JSON数据 作为一名经验丰富的开发者,我将向你介绍如何使用PythonRedis保存JSON数据。在本文中,我将展示整个实现过程,包括步骤、代码和注释。 ### 实现步骤 下面是实现保存JSON数据到Redis的步骤: | 步骤 | 描述 | | --- | --- | | 步骤1 | 安装redis-py库 | | 步骤2 | 导入所需的库 | |
原创 2024-01-17 08:26:15
159阅读
# 存储JSONRedis的实现步骤 ## 简介 在本篇文章中,我将教会你如何使用PythonJSON数据存储到Redis中。我们将使用Pythonredis模块来连接和操作Redis数据库。下面是整个过程的流程图: ```mermaid gantt title 存储JSONRedis的实现步骤 dateFormat YYYY-MM-DD section 设置
原创 2023-09-06 17:50:46
304阅读
# 如何将Python Redis结果转换为JSON ## 概述 在开发过程中,我们经常使用Redis作为缓存数据库来存储和检索数据。当我们从Redis中检索数据时,通常需要将这些数据转换为JSON格式,以便在我们的应用程序中进行处理。本文将指导您如何使用PythonRedis结果转换为JSON格式。 ## 步骤概览 下面的表格展示了将Redis结果转换为JSON的步骤概览: | 步骤 |
原创 2023-10-16 10:37:29
362阅读
# Python Redis JSON存储中文的实践 Redis是一种高性能的键值存储数据库,它在处理各种数据类型时表现优异。近年来,随着JSON(JavaScript Object Notation)成为数据传输最常用的格式之一,许多开发者开始将JSON数据存储在Redis中。不过,存储中文字符时,往往会遇到编码问题。本文将介绍如何在Python中使用RedisJSON存储中文,同时通过代码
原创 2024-08-15 05:20:03
76阅读
# Python使用Redis存储JSON数据 ## 1. 简介 Redis是一个高性能的开源键值数据库,支持多种数据类型,包括字符串、列表、哈希、集合和有序集合。在Python中,我们可以使用Redis来存储和处理JSON数据。 本文将通过以下步骤来教会你如何使用PythonJSON数据存储到Redis中: 1. 连接到Redis服务器 2. 将JSON数据转换为字符串 3. 将JSO
原创 2023-11-26 10:12:35
128阅读
RedisJSON 是Redis的第三方拓展模块,它实现了JSON数据类型的支持,允许对JSON数据进行快速增、删、查改操作,它比在MongoDB读写分别快了12.7和5.4倍,比在ElasticSearch读写分别快了500和200倍,是一个高性能的操作模块想尝鲜RedisJSON的最容易方式是使用Docker了,我在这里也是使用Docker进行安装 使用Docker拉取镜像第一次运行,需要从仓
转载 2023-09-08 23:33:27
217阅读
RedisJSON 是一种高性能 JSON 文档存储,允许开发人员构建现代应用程序。它在内存中存储和处理 JSON,以亚毫秒级支持每秒数百万次操作响应时间。 JSON 文档的原生索引、查询和全文搜索允许开发人员创建二级索引,快速查询数据。企业无法满足现代应用需求刚性数据库模式限制了敏捷性关系数据库管理系统 (RDBMS) 具有难以更新和扩展的刚性数据模式。基于磁盘的文档存储导致瓶颈文档存储允许开发
redis中用的最多的就是hash和string类型。 问题假设有User对象以JSON序列化的形式存储到redis中,User对象有id、username、password、age、name等属性,存储的过程如下:保存、更新:User对象->json(string)->redis如果在业务上只是更新age属性,其他的属性并不做更新应该怎么做呢?Redis数据类型之散列类型
转载 2023-08-04 16:11:05
109阅读
开源了一个 Lua 的 JSON 解析库 LuaJSONLib,基于 cJSON 效率比较高,在关闭嵌套层数限制的情况下,每秒可以递归解析 1500 层 JSON 数据 API 总览名称功能value = Load(str)将已编码的 JSON 对象解码为 Lua 对象value = LoadFromFile(path)将指定路径文件中已编码的 JSON 对象解码为 Lua 对象str = Dum
转载 2023-06-21 17:14:53
430阅读
redis对象保存方式?一、redis对象保存方式?二、Redis数据淘汰机制 一、redis对象保存方式?  Json字符串: 需要把对象转换为json字符串,当做字符串处理。直接使用set get来设置或者或。   优点:设置和获取比较简单   缺点:没有提供专门的方法,需要把把对象转换为json。(jsonlib) 字节:   需要做序列号,就是把对象序列化为字节保存。如果是担心JSON
转载 2023-05-30 12:32:38
423阅读
 # 概述近期官网给出了RedisJson(RedisSearch)的性能测试报告,可谓碾压其他NoSQL,下面是核心的报告内容,先上结论:对于隔离写入(isolated writes),RedisJSON 比 MongoDB 快 5.4 倍,比 ElasticSearch 快 200 倍以上。对于隔离读取(isolated reads),RedisJSON 比 MongoDB 快 12
转载 2023-10-29 23:46:52
23阅读
  • 1
  • 2
  • 3
  • 4
  • 5